CHENEY – The city’s police and fire chiefs were asked by City Council at its Nov. 24 meeting to peer into their crystal balls and offer a view of what their departments might look like in the future should certain aspects of their operations change.
For Fire Chief Tom Jenkins, that look involved the ongoing issue with emergency medical response in the community — specifically ambulance service.
